Adobe Firefly
- Trained on licensed content: safe for commercial use
- Fully integrated with Photoshop, Illustrator and Creative Cloud
- Unlimited standard generations on the paid plans
- Artistic quality behind Midjourney in some styles
- Credit system is somewhat confusing for premium features (video)
Photoroom
- Excellent product cut-outs, even with hair, glass or shadows
- Batch processing: entire catalogues in one go
- API with clear per-image pricing ($0.10) for online stores
- The free plan watermarks output, useless for selling
- No high-resolution export or batches on the free plan
